EVCC auf Display anzeigen - Anleitung

OpenWB nachgebaut?
Bericht über die Umsetzung hier rein!
openWB
Site Admin
Beiträge: 9884
Registriert: So Okt 07, 2018 1:50 pm
Has thanked: 118 times
Been thanked: 283 times

Re: EVCC auf Display anzeigen - Anleitung

Beitrag von openWB »

Alternativ direkt per MQTT und nicht per modbusTCP steuern!?
Supportanfragen bitte NICHT per PN stellen.
Hardwareprobleme bitte über die Funktion Debug Daten senden mitteilen oder per Mail an support@openwb.de
Gero
Beiträge: 4762
Registriert: Sa Feb 20, 2021 9:55 am
Has thanked: 54 times
Been thanked: 301 times

Re: EVCC auf Display anzeigen - Anleitung

Beitrag von Gero »

ChristianM hat geschrieben: Sa Dez 27, 2025 5:53 pm Wie wird der Secondary denn die URL von der Primary mitgeteilt? MQTT?
In der modbus-Doku findet sich nichts, was eine IP-Adresse oder ein URL wäre. Von daher wird‘s wohl per MQTT übergeben.

Bei deinen KI-Analysen müsstest du darauf achen, ob da ein URL-Pfad oder ein Topic zusammengesetzt wird. Die sehen gleich aus, sind aber doch was anderes.
openWB-pro+, openWB-Buchse, E3/DC S10pro+19.5kWh, 30kWp Ost-Süd, Model 3 und Ion
agapsch
Beiträge: 5
Registriert: Di Dez 23, 2025 9:49 pm
Has thanked: 3 times
Been thanked: 1 time

Re: EVCC auf Display anzeigen - Anleitung

Beitrag von agapsch »

Frank-H hat geschrieben: Fr Dez 26, 2025 3:55 pm EVCC lauffähig auf OpenWB (mit oder ohne Display) gibt es schon:

https://github.com/evcc-io/evcc/pull/21984

und follow-ups (suche: openwb)
Ich betreibe eine openWB Series 2 Standard+ sowie eine openWB Pro+. Ziel ist es, eine zentrale EVCC-Instanz zu nutzen, welche auch weitere Homelab-Services (z. B. Home Assistant) hostet, anstatt mehrere EVCC-Instanzen zu betreiben.

Der MQTT-basierte Ansatz wurde ebenfalls evaluiert, ist jedoch aufgrund des automatischen Zurücksetzens auf null bei jeder Anfrage nicht praktikabel. Der Nutzen dieses Verhaltens ist aus meiner Sicht nicht nachvollziehbar, da es eine stabile externe URL-Referenz faktisch verhindert.

Aus technischer Sicht wäre eine saubere und robuste Lösung, wenn der von openWB verwendete Display-Pfad bzw. die URL als Variable implementiert wäre:

- Standardmässig automatisch gesetzt – sowohl im Primary- als auch im Secondary-Modus
- Im Secondary-Modus zusätzlich manuell überschreibbar, um externe Systeme wie EVCC korrekt einbinden zu können

Der aktuell notwendige Einsatz von NGINX-Proxys, Redirects oder Rewrite-Regeln ist aus meiner Sicht lediglich ein Workaround und erhöht unnötig die Komplexität sowie die Fehleranfälligkeit.

Sollte eine erhöhte Last tatsächlich ein relevantes Thema sein, liesse sich dies technisch sehr einfach durch einen Hinweis oder eine Warnung adressieren. Ich gehe jedoch davon aus, dass die zusätzliche Last in der Praxis keine messbare Auswirkung auf openWB haben würde.
openWB
Site Admin
Beiträge: 9884
Registriert: So Okt 07, 2018 1:50 pm
Has thanked: 118 times
Been thanked: 283 times

Re: EVCC auf Display anzeigen - Anleitung

Beitrag von openWB »

Aus technischer Sicht wäre eine saubere und robuste Lösung, wenn der von openWB verwendete Display-Pfad bzw. die URL als Variable implementiert wäre:
Diese Sichtweise trifft nun aber erstmal nur auf deinen speziellen Fall zu.

Sollte eine erhöhte Last tatsächlich ein relevantes Thema sein, liesse sich dies technisch sehr einfach durch einen Hinweis oder eine Warnung adressieren. Ich gehe jedoch davon aus, dass die zusätzliche Last in der Praxis keine messbare Auswirkung auf openWB haben würde.
Les doch bitte meinen Beitrag:
viewtopic.php?p=137965#p137965
Unsere Erfahrung zeigt das eine Warnung eben nicht ausreicht und unsere internen Tests zeigen erhebliches Potential für eingeschränkte Nutzbarkeit.

Im Gegenzug ist aber alles so offen das du es dir nach deinen Wünschen anpassen kannst und angepasst hast.
Damit sind doch beide Seiten happy, oder nicht !?
Supportanfragen bitte NICHT per PN stellen.
Hardwareprobleme bitte über die Funktion Debug Daten senden mitteilen oder per Mail an support@openwb.de
Antworten